Cab/Camille

Cab and Camille were both owned by Camille E. Hodge and operated out of New York.

The label ran from the mid 1960s to the late 1970s, featuring calypso greats such as Lord Nelson and the Mighty Duke amongst others.

The biggest hit on the label was King Wellington's "Steel and Brass" (1973).

Initial releases were on the Cab label, which was used until about 1970. Subsequent releases were on Camille.

A lot of the singles on Camille were taken from their albums.

We have recently received information on a record with catalogue number Cab 3004 - "Remember Me" b/w "Come on Home" by Jimmy Lomax and the Vows. Is there another series of Cab records? Please e-mail us if you know!

Jimmy Lomax appears to be a soul singer; he released further records on the Camille label (see below) including one arranged by Horace Ott, who is well know to Soul/Northern Soul fans and later arranged "Y.M.C.A." by the Village People!
